In this satirical sci-fi musical comedy, four space travellers awaken on the H.M.S Porcus, excited to start their new lives on a distant colony with the promise of saving humanity-until the ship's uncooperative Al, Jessica, informs the crew that they have gained a massive amount of weight while in suspended animation.
Now deemed a "drain on resources," they are doomed to explode with the ship unless they lose enough weight to pass the new world's standards. What starts as a desperate weight-loss mission quickly unravels into a battle against bureaucratic absurdity, corporate negligence, and the very definition of human worth. With a mix of sharp humour, musical numbers, and unexpected twists, Pigs Fly is a hilarious and biting critique of diet culture, capitalism, and the impossible standards society places on our bodies.

GREG CARRUTHERS (HE/SHE)
DIRECTOR + PRODUCTION DESIGNER
Greg is an award-winning content producer, choreographer and intimacy director based in Toronto, Canada. Greg has choreographed for The Second City, PepsiCo, Canada's Wonderland, The Grand Theatre (London) and the Madinat Theatre (Dubai). As an educator, Greg works with Sheridan College, St. Clair College, U of T, TMU, and York U Greg has produced events through his company "EveryBODY on Stage" for Comedy Bar, Musical Stage Co and Buddies in Bad Times Theatre which has garnered him a Premier's Award Nomination.
In addition, Greg has amassed a following of 30k+ on social media and through their support received a People's Choice Webby award, presenting his speech on stage in NYC with Anderson Cooper, SZA and more. ABOUT EVERYBODY
OUR MISSION
EveryBODY on Stage aims to break down stigma and fat-phobia in the arts.
Our goal is to reduce the harm done by body dysmorphia and disordered eating on the long-term health of artists and to encourage the positive representation of all body-types on stage.
As we fight for representation, we will actively seek out voices underrepresented because of race, ancestry, place of origin, ethnicity, citizenship, creed, disability, sex, sexual orientation, gender identity, age, marital status, and/or family status.
